What oil filter do I need for a 2014 Honda Civic?

The correct oil filter for a 2014 Honda Civic depends on which engine you have. If your car uses the 1.8-liter inline-four, you’ll need the filter matched to that engine; if it’s the 2.4-liter inline-four used in the Civic Si, you’ll need the 2.4L-specific filter. In practice, purchase a Honda Genuine oil filter that corresponds to your engine code, or consult a dealer for the exact part number for your VIN.


Two engine options in the 2014 Civic


For the 2014 Civic, there were two main engine choices in North America. The base trims used the 1.8L engine, while the higher-performance Si used a 2.4L engine. The right filter is tied to which engine is installed under the hood.

How to confirm the exact part


Because part numbers can shift with regional catalogs and year refinements, the most reliable method is to verify via VIN or engine code. Here is how to proceed:


Below is a quick, practical checklist you can follow to confirm the correct filter:



  • Identify your engine code and model trim (1.8L LX/EX or 2.4L Si).

  • Check the owner's manual or service booklet for the recommended oil filter part number.

  • Cross-check with the official Honda parts catalog or contact a dealer for the exact OEM filter for your VIN.

  • If choosing aftermarket, ensure the filter is specified as compatible with the 1.8L or 2.4L Civic of that year.


Using the right filter ensures proper oil flow, filtration efficiency, and a reliable seal, helping maintain engine health and oil pressure.
